Govt to send 10,000 nurses to UK

150 to be sent in first phase



KATHMANDU: The Nepal government is making preparations to send 10,000 nurses to the United Kingdom.

The Ministry of Employment and Social Security has not made public the level of nursing manpower to be sent.

Rajiv Pokharel, head of the ministry’s employment management division, said the criteria for nurses going to the UK would be made public once the cabinet approves the labor agreement.

Mankumari Rai, president of the Nursing Association of Nepal, shared that she had received information about the demand for 10,000 staff nurses from the UK.

Out of the 10,000 nursing manpower demanded by the British government, only 150 nurses are being in the first phase, said Rajiv Pokharel.

Pokharel said that additional manpower would be sent only after looking into all the aspects including pay perks for those going in the first phase.

According to the Nepal Nursing Council, 598 specialists, 67,316 nurses, 28 midwives, 36,446 ANMs and 845 foreign nurses have been registered in Nepal so far.
